New Products and Mediums
Progress in science and technological know-how have revolutionized the incredibly elements painters use, reshaping what is achievable inside of standard painting practices. In before generations, artists relied on normal pigments derived from minerals, vegetation, or insects—sources that were normally exceptional, unstable, or susceptible to fading with time. These days, chemistry and material science have released synthetic pigments with higher longevity, regularity, and vibrancy, ensuring that hues continue being as hanging decades afterwards as they were being to the day of software.
Among the list of most important improvements has actually been the refinement of acrylic paints. Very first developed during the 20th century, acrylics dry quicker than oils, resist cracking, and can be employed on a wide variety of surfaces, from canvas and Wooden to plastics and metals. Present day formulations even mimic the richness and blending features of oils or even the translucency of watercolors, offering painters overall flexibility without having sacrificing traditional aesthetics. Equally, specialized varnishes and protecting coatings shield paintings from UV rays, dampness, and pollutants, extending their longevity in ways unimaginable to previously generations.
New mediums are not limited to pigments by itself. Synthetic brushes built to mimic organic bristles have become far more durable and functional, while environmentally friendly products and solutions are progressively changing damaging solvents. Technology has also expanded the physical surfaces artists can paint on—dealt with metals, acrylic panels, as well as fabrics created for pigment retention open up up novel avenues of expression although retaining the tactile essence of portray.

Preserving Custom Via Know-how
While engineering generally drives innovation, one of its most profound impacts on painting lies in preservation. Classic artworks, Primarily those centuries outdated, are liable to time, environmental damage, and human handling. Engineering now delivers powerful resources to guard, restore, and document these treasures though making sure that traditional methods continue to be available to long run generations.
Significant-resolution imaging and electronic scanning allow for museums and conservationists to study paintings in extraordinary depth, revealing underdrawings, brushstroke designs, or pigments invisible for the naked eye. Infrared and X-ray technologies, by way of example, uncover artists’ initial sketches beneath levels of paint, supplying Perception into historic solutions and conclusions though guiding exact restoration. Such tools not only preserve the integrity of artworks but also deepen our understanding of how standard strategies developed.
Superior supplies also contribute to preservation. Conservation scientists now use specialized varnishes, adhesives, and protective coatings that stabilize fragile works without altering their appearance. Electronic archiving further more makes sure longevity—masterpieces are captured in specific reproductions, letting people globally to experience them pretty much regardless of whether the originals are way too delicate to display.
